Is Code Vein Difficult?
Code Vein, a action role-playing game developed by Bandai Namco, has sparked a lot of debate among gamers about its difficulty level. Some players find it challenging, while others consider it relatively easy. In this article, we’ll delve into the game’s mechanics and provide an honest assessment of its difficulty.
Is Code Vein a Souls-like Game?
Before we dive into the game’s difficulty, it’s essential to understand that Code Vein is often compared to the Souls series. While it shares some similarities with the Souls games, it’s not a direct clone. Code Vein has its own unique mechanics, and its difficulty is distinct from the Souls series.
Code Vein’s Difficulty
Code Vein’s difficulty is often described as " Souls-like" because of its challenging boss battles and tough enemies. However, the game’s difficulty is not as punishing as the Souls series. Code Vein’s difficulty is more about strategy and timing than pure memorization. The game rewards players who take their time to learn enemy patterns and use the right strategies to overcome challenges.
Enemies and Bosses
Enemies in Code Vein are aggressive and can be challenging to defeat, especially in later stages. Boss battles are the most challenging part of the game, requiring players to use the right strategies and timing to defeat them. Bosses have unique patterns and attacks, making each battle a unique experience.
